Item Description
6x8.5” cardboard. Lollipop holder for candy by Brandle & Smith Co. of Phila. who also made Mickey candy bars. Dates to 1933. Front depicts Mickey walking and holding a lollipop in one hand, other arm is die-cut and movable as are Mickey’s eyes and ears. Opens to reveal a variety of different small images of Mickey and Minnie along with lollipop-related poem. Also attached inside is die-cut card which originally held lollipops. This once blank surface is covered by a penciled story, done at the time, noting how the lollipops were originally obtained by a boy who was given them as a gift from a woman who felt sorry for him after his fingers got caught in a door. Trace of aging/edge wear. Fine. A rare item further enhanced by the interesting provenance.
